Technical Engineering & Material Comparative Matrix
Selecting the correct substrate and glazing package is critical when specifying bow windows for South Africa’s harsh microclimates—ranging from the high UV solar radiation of Gauteng to the corrosive sea spray environment of KwaZulu-Natal and the Western Cape. Below is a comprehensive engineering comparison between our flagship export-grade thermal break aluminum bow systems and heavy-duty uPVC bow windows:
| Performance Indicator | Thermal Break Aluminum Bow Windows | Heavy-Duty uPVC Bow Windows | South African Standard Target |
|---|---|---|---|
| Thermal Conductivity (U-Value) | 1.6 – 2.0 W/m²K (Double Low-E) | 1.2 – 1.5 W/m²K (Triple Glazed) | ≤ 2.2 W/m²K (SANS 10400-XA) |
| Wind Pressure Resistance | Class 5A (> 4000 Pa Structural Load) | Class 4A (2400 Pa Structural Load) | A3 Rating (AAAMSA Compliant) |
| Corrosion Resistance Rating | C5-M Marine Grade Fluorocarbon Coating | 100% Salt-Proof UV Stabilized Compound | Coastal Salt Fog Tested (1500 hrs) |
| Frame Sightline Width | Ultra-Slim (45mm - 65mm profile) | Classic Profile (70mm - 88mm profile) | Architectural Preference Varies |
| Security / Anti-Burglary | Grade 3 Multi-Point Cam Locks + Laminated Glass | Steel-Reinforced Core + Multi-Point Dogs | PAS 24 / High Intrusion Barrier |
| Acoustic Insulation (Rw) | 38 dB - 45 dB (Acoustic PVB Interlayer) | 35 dB - 42 dB (Argon Filled IGU) | City / High-Traffic Noise Control |
Localized Application Scenarios in South African Architecture
Unlike standard flat windows, a bow window extends outward from the exterior wall envelope, creating an elegant architectural curve that captures natural light from multiple angles, maximizes floor space, and unlocks panoramic vistas. To ensure seamless structural integration in South African construction practices, our engineering team optimizes designs for specific regional applications:
1. Cape Town Coastal Villas
Exposed to Cape Doctor winds and intense Atlantic humidity, these installations utilize high-impact anodized or C5 marine-grade powder-coated aluminum frames. Double-glazed units featuring 6mm Tempered + 12Ar + 6mm Low-E glass prevent wind-driven rain penetration up to 600 Pa while providing dramatic ocean views.
2. Highveld Gated Estates (Gauteng)
In regions like Sandton, Pretoria, and Midrand, extreme diurnal temperature variations (freezing winter nights and blistering summer days) require high thermal inertia. Our thermal break bow windows filled with argon gas eliminate thermal bridging, cutting winter heating costs significantly.
3. Durban & KZN Tropical Resorts
Subtropical weather in KwaZulu-Natal demands superior weather stripping and humidity-resistant hardware. EPDM double-seal gaskets combined with German Siegenia or GU multi-point locks prevent moisture ingress and profile warping caused by intense solar exposure.
4. Security-Enhanced Urban Homes
Addressing South Africa's critical residential security needs, our custom bow assemblies can be prefabricated with integrated stainless steel intruder mesh (Fly & Security Screen Combo) and shatterproof 8.76mm or 10.76mm PVB laminated security glass panels.

Manufacturing Excellence & Quality Control Protocol
Rooted in over 50 years of fabrication heritage and continuous technological innovation, our manufacturing complex operates advanced CNC double-head cutting saws, automated corner crimping stations, and robotic glass glazing lines. Every bow window frame destined for South Africa undergoes rigorous quality checks:
1. Spectrometric Alloy Verification
We utilize primary 6063-T5 aluminum extrusions with strict wall thickness tolerances (≥ 1.4mm for windows, ≥ 2.0mm for structural mullions) ensuring lifelong structural rigidity without sagging.
2. Automated Sealant Application
Dual-component silicone structural adhesive is applied automatically within controlled cleanroom environments to guarantee complete hermetic sealing for insulated glass units (IGUs).
3. Pre-Shipment Trial Assembly
Every bow window assembly undergoes 100% factory dry-fitting to verify radial mullion alignment, sash operation smoothness, and seal compression prior to export packaging.
